Darren Price, 45, was bailed for a pre-sentence report, while charges against Anne Price, 29, are to lie on file

A former bus company employee admitted false accounting involving bogus invoice claims to Gwynedd council.
It follows a probe into Padarn Buses at Llanberis and an alleged £800,000 fraud.
Darren Price, 45, of Minffordd Estate, Llanrug, Caernarfon, was bailed for a pre-sentence report. Recorder Duncan Bould told him at Caernarfon crown court: ”You will be entitled to credit in respect of the guilty plea you have entered.”
Fraud and false accounting allegations denied by Anne Price, 29, of High Street, Llanberis, are to lie on file at the request of the prosecution.
Prosecutor Jayne La Grua told the judge :”The issue would have been the extent of her knowledge.”
A second man is due to stand trial in connection with an alleged fiddle involving hundreds of thousands of pounds.
